1. Introduction to URL Shortening
URL shortening is a way online during which a lengthy URL might be transformed right into a shorter, additional manageable type. This shortened URL redirects to the first prolonged URL when visited. Companies like Bitly and TinyURL are well-known samples of URL shorteners. The necessity for URL shortening arose with the arrival of social media marketing platforms like Twitter, the place character limits for posts built it challenging to share lengthy URLs.

Further than social media, URL shorteners are helpful in advertising and marketing campaigns, e-mails, and printed media where by lengthy URLs might be cumbersome.

two. Core Parts of the URL Shortener
A URL shortener usually includes the following parts:

World-wide-web Interface: This can be the front-end aspect exactly where buyers can enter their lengthy URLs and get shortened variations. It might be a straightforward form with a Web content.
Database: A database is important to retailer the mapping amongst the initial long URL along with the shortened Model. Databases like MySQL, PostgreSQL, or NoSQL selections like MongoDB may be used.
Redirection Logic: This is actually the backend logic that normally takes the small URL and redirects the person to your corresponding lengthy URL. This logic is normally applied in the world wide web server or an software layer.
API: Several URL shorteners give an API making sure that 3rd-occasion apps can programmatically shorten URLs and retrieve the first prolonged URLs.
three. Creating the URL Shortening Algorithm
The crux of a URL shortener lies in its algorithm for changing a protracted URL into a short 1. Numerous approaches might be utilized, for example:

Hashing: The lengthy URL can be hashed into a set-dimensions string, which serves as the quick URL. Even so, hash collisions (distinctive URLs causing a similar hash) should be managed.
Base62 Encoding: 1 frequent approach is to make use of Base62 encoding (which makes use of sixty two figures: 0-9, A-Z, in addition to a-z) on an integer ID. The ID corresponds to your entry from the databases. This process ensures that the quick URL is as small as feasible.
Random String Era: Another method is always to generate a random string of a fixed length (e.g., six characters) and Test if it’s now in use from the database. Otherwise, it’s assigned to the extended URL.
4. Databases Management
The databases schema for the URL shortener will likely be easy, with two Major fields:

ID: A novel identifier for every URL entry.
Very long URL: The first URL that needs to be shortened.
Shorter URL/Slug: The limited Edition of your URL, often saved as a singular string.
In addition to these, it is advisable to shop metadata including the development date, expiration date, and the volume of occasions the quick URL is accessed.

five. Dealing with Redirection
Redirection is actually a crucial Element of the URL shortener's operation. Every time a person clicks on a short URL, the services should swiftly retrieve the first URL in the databases and redirect the user using an HTTP 301 (everlasting redirect) or 302 (short-term redirect) standing code.

Effectiveness is vital here, as the method needs to be approximately instantaneous. Tactics like databases indexing and caching (e.g., making use of Redis or Memcached) is usually utilized to hurry up the retrieval procedure.

six. Stability Factors
Stability is a significant problem in URL shorteners:

Destructive URLs: A URL shortener can be abused to spread malicious inbound links. Implementing URL validation, blacklisting, or integrating with third-social gathering safety expert services to examine URLs just before shortening them can mitigate this threat.
Spam Avoidance: Level limiting and CAPTCHA can avert abuse by spammers trying to produce 1000s of shorter URLs.
seven. Scalability
As being the URL shortener grows, it might have to manage a lot of URLs and redirect requests. This requires a scalable architecture, possibly involving load balancers, distributed databases, and microservices.

Load Balancing: Distribute site visitors across several servers to deal with large loads.
Distributed Databases: Use databases that may scale horizontally, like Cassandra or MongoDB.
Microservices: Separate concerns like URL shortening, analytics, and redirection into different services to further improve scalability and maintainability.
eight. Analytics
URL shorteners typically give analytics to track how often a brief URL is clicked, the place the targeted traffic is coming from, and also other beneficial metrics. This demands logging each redirect And maybe integrating with analytics platforms.
